rep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Specify the depth range in surface_depth_blt().
2012-02-15
A
n
drew Eikum
w
inealsa
.
drv
:
Optional
l
y l
o
a
d
ex
t
ra ALSA device name
s
.
.
.
commit
|
commitdiff
|
tree
2012-02-15
Andr
e
w Eikum
mmdevapi: Only
return ACTIVE d
e
v
i
ces from
G
etDefaultA
u
dio
E
nd
.
.
.
commit
|
commitdiff
|
tree
2012-02-14
Andrew Eikum
dsound:
Add some more DSCAPS flag
s
.
commit
|
commitdiff
|
tree
2012-02-07
Andrew E
i
kum
winm
m
: TRACE unh
a
ndl
e
d message
s
.
commit
|
commitdiff
|
tree
2012-02-07
A
n
drew E
i
kum
wi
n
mm: Dow
n
grade most ERRs to WARNs
.
commit
|
commitdiff
|
tree
2012-02-07
Andrew Eikum
w
ineoss
.
drv: Do
w
ngrade most ERRs
t
o WARNs
.
commit
|
commitdiff
|
tree
2012-02-06
Andrew Eikum
wineoss
.
d
r
v: Don
'
t cal
l
GETOSPACE immediately
after
.
.
.
commit
|
commitdiff
|
tree
2012-02-06
Andrew
E
ikum
hlink:
D
on't query
t
he IHlin
k
Si
t
e if the IMoniker is
.
.
.
commit
|
commitdiff
|
tree
2012-02-06
Andrew Eikum
hli
n
k: Al
w
ays pass a bi
n
d context to IMoniker::GetDispl
a
yName
.
commit
|
commitdiff
|
tree
2012-02-01
And
r
ew Eik
u
m
winecoreaudio: Improve
un
d
errun ha
n
d
ling
.
commit
|
commitdiff
|
tree
2012-01-31
Andrew Eikum
winmm: Initializ
e
COM for MULT
I
THREADED, not APARTMENT
T
HREADED
.
commit
|
commitdiff
|
tree
2012-01-30
An
d
rew
Eikum
mmdevapi: Corre
c
tly convert UIN
T
32 to
LONG32
.
commit
|
commitdiff
|
tree
2012-01-27
Andrew Eikum
w
inealsa: Avo
i
d
u
nderrun by
a
dding a lead-in
w
h
e
n starting
.
.
.
commit
|
commitdiff
|
tree
2012-01-25
Andrew Ei
k
um
wineoss
.
drv: Fix buffer offset calculation
.
commit
|
commitdiff
|
tree
2012-01-25
An
d
r
e
w
E
i
k
um
wineoss
.
d
r
v
:
Use GETODEL
A
Y inst
e
ad of GETOSPACE to
.
.
.
commit
|
commitdiff
|
tree
2012-01-25
Andrew Eikum
w
i
n
eoss
.
d
rv: Deco
u
ple MMDevAPI b
u
ff
e
r and
O
SS buffer
.
commit
|
commitdiff
|
tree
2012-01-17
Andrew Eikum
dsou
n
d: Lock the
source buff
e
r duri
n
g duplication
.
commit
|
commitdiff
|
tree
2012-01-16
Andrew Ei
k
um
dsound: Don't launch a separate thread f
o
r the mmdevapi
.
.
.
commit
|
commitdiff
|
tree
2012-01-16
Andr
e
w Eikum
winmm: On
l
y start the devices
thread when necessary
.
commit
|
commitdiff
|
tree
2012-01-12
A
n
drew E
i
kum
wineals
a
.
dr
v
: Remove "strange numbe
r
of chan
n
e
ls" FIXME
.
commit
|
commitdiff
|
tree
2012-01-10
A
ndrew
Eikum
itss: Use case-insensitive
strcmp
.
commit
|
commitdiff
|
tree
2012-01-10
A
n
drew E
i
kum
msht
m
l: Fix WARN typo
.
commit
|
commitdiff
|
tree
2012-01-10
Andrew Ei
k
um
w
i
n
eos
s
.
drv: Fix I
A
ud
i
oRenderClient::{Get,Rel
e
ase
}
Buff
e
r
.
.
.
commit
|
commitdiff
|
tree
2011-12-20
Andrew Eikum
winealsa
.
drv: Limit the
d
ata wri
t
ten
t
o
ALSA'
s
buff
e
r
.
commit
|
commitdiff
|
tree
2011-12-05
Andrew Eik
u
m
wineoss
.
drv: Don'
t
s
e
t volu
m
e in IAudioC
l
ient::Initiali
z
e
.
commit
|
commitdiff
|
tree
2011-12-05
Andrew E
i
kum
dsound
:
V
a
l
idate f
o
rmat in primary buffer's SetFormat()
.
commit
|
commitdiff
|
tree
2011-12-01
A
ndrew Eiku
m
wine
o
ss
.
drv: Add period to latenc
y
ca
l
culat
i
on
.
commit
|
commitdiff
|
tree
2011-12-01
A
ndrew Eiku
m
wine
o
ss
.
drv: Remov
e
vo
l
ume sett
i
ng sup
p
ort
.
commit
|
commitdiff
|
tree
2011-11-22
And
r
ew Eikum
winecoreaudio
.
drv: Ma
k
e dri
v
er
s
ample ac
c
ur
a
te
.
commit
|
commitdiff
|
tree
2011-11-22
Andrew Eikum
wine
c
oreaudio
.
drv: Fix late
n
cy calculation
.
commit
|
commitdiff
|
tree
2011-11-15
A
nd
r
ew Eikum
d
so
u
nd: Don't specify period
size for the IA
u
d
i
oClient
.
commit
|
commitdiff
|
tree
2011-11-15
Andrew Ei
k
um
u
rlmon: Improve parsing of
S
CHEME_MK
U
RIs
.
commit
|
commitdiff
|
tree
2011-11-01
A
ndrew
E
i
k
u
m
w
i
n
e
cfg: Play test sound asynchronously
.
commit
|
commitdiff
|
tree
2011-10-28
Andrew
Eik
u
m
winmm: Fix cl
o
ck po
s
ition c
a
l
c
ulation
.
commit
|
commitdiff
|
tree
2011-10-28
And
r
ew Ei
k
um
wi
n
ecfg: D
o
n't relo
a
d wi
n
mm f
o
r
each
a
ud
i
o test
.
commit
|
commitdiff
|
tree
2011-10-21
Andrew E
i
ku
m
d
s
ound: A
l
ways e
n
u
me
r
a
te the defaul
t
device
f
irst
.
commit
|
commitdiff
|
tree
2011-10-20
Andr
e
w Eikum
dso
u
nd:
D
o
n
'
t cl
a
im
to suppo
r
t
ha
r
dware buffers
.
commit
|
commitdiff
|
tree
2011-10-19
A
n
drew Eiku
m
shell32: ShellExec w
i
th e
m
pty
o
p
e
r
ation should beha
v
e
.
.
.
commit
|
commitdiff
|
tree
2011-10-18
Andrew
E
ikum
d
sound: Don't make the capt
u
re
buff
e
r obj
e
ct
addres
s
.
.
.
commit
|
commitdiff
|
tree
2011-10-18
Andrew E
i
kum
d
s
ound: Fix type conversion p
r
oblems
.
commit
|
commitdiff
|
tree
2011-10-13
Andrew Eikum
winealsa
.
drv: Fix inv
a
l
i
d pointer
derefe
r
ence
on error
.
.
.
commit
|
commitdiff
|
tree
2011-10-13
And
r
ew Eiku
m
wi
n
ecoreaudio
.
drv: Do
n
't fail if set
t
i
ng vol
u
me
f
a
ils
.
commit
|
commitdiff
|
tree
2011-10-13
An
d
rew
Eik
u
m
dsound:
Requ
e
st
a m
o
re exa
c
t buffer size from MMDevAPI
.
commit
|
commitdiff
|
tree
2011-10-12
Andrew Eikum
wi
n
mm
:
Us
e
buffer off
s
et
when r
e
cording
.
commit
|
commitdiff
|
tree
2011-10-12
Andrew Eikum
winmm: Also track input dev
i
ce posi
t
ion
.
commit
|
commitdiff
|
tree
2011-10-12
A
ndre
w
Eikum
wineoss
.
d
rv: Only write as
m
uch data
a
s
will fit i
n
to
.
.
.
commit
|
commitdiff
|
tree
2011-10-11
Andrew Eik
u
m
wineos
s
.
drv: Tr
i
m the
s
ub-device
p
art of the device
.
.
.
commit
|
commitdiff
|
tree
2011-10-11
A
n
dre
w
E
i
kum
winealsa
.
drv: Don't t
r
y to contr
o
l
ALSA's behavior
.
commit
|
commitdiff
|
tree
2011-10-06
A
n
d
rew Eik
u
m
ds
o
und: Fix fragment
position calcu
l
atio
n
s
.
commit
|
commitdiff
|
tree
2011-10-05
A
ndrew Eikum
dso
u
nd: Remove a few unu
s
e
d
v
ariable
s
.
commit
|
commitdiff
|
tree
2011-10-05
Andre
w
E
ikum
winecfg: A
l
low
u
ser to
s
e
lect
d
efault audio devices
.
commit
|
commitdiff
|
tree
2011-10-05
A
n
drew Eikum
m
mdevapi: Attempt to determ
i
ne default device
s
from
.
.
.
commit
|
commitdiff
|
tree
2011-10-05
Andrew Eiku
m
w
inecfg: R
e
l
o
ad wi
n
mm for ea
c
h sound test
.
commit
|
commitdiff
|
tree
2011-10-05
Andrew Eikum
aud
i
o: Change
win
m
m import to
delay
e
d impo
r
t
.
commit
|
commitdiff
|
tree
2011-10-04
Andrew Eikum
w
inm
m
: Handle D
R
V_QUERY
M
A
P
P
ABLE in
w
aveX
x
xMessage
.
commit
|
commitdiff
|
tree
2011-09-30
Andrew Eikum
mmdevapi: D
o
n't u
s
e invalid This pointer on st
a
tic
.
.
.
commit
|
commitdiff
|
tree
2011-09-30
A
n
drew Eikum
wi
n
e
a
l
sa
.
d
r
v:
Fix d
e
fault
device cre
a
tion
l
ogic
.
commit
|
commitdiff
|
tree
2011-09-28
A
n
dre
w
Eiku
m
win
e
oss
.
drv: Use
a te
m
porary OSS device to check format
.
.
.
commit
|
commitdiff
|
tree
2011-09-28
Andrew Ei
k
um
mmdevapi: Don't fa
i
l
i
f
d
wChannelMask is not set correc
t
l
y
.
commit
|
commitdiff
|
tree
2011-09-28
Andrew Eik
u
m
d
s
ou
n
d: Eliminate leftover dri
v
er structures
.
commit
|
commitdiff
|
tree
2011-09-27
Andrew Eik
u
m
d
s
o
u
nd:
R
eimplement P
r
op
e
rtySet on mmdevapi
.
commit
|
commitdiff
|
tree
2011-09-27
An
d
rew E
i
kum
dsound:
R
eimpl
e
ment capturing
d
evices
on
m
mdevapi
.
commit
|
commitdiff
|
tree
2011-09-27
Andrew Eikum
dsound: Re
i
mpl
e
m
e
nt render
i
ng devices on mmdev
a
p
i
.
commit
|
commitdiff
|
tree
2011-09-27
Andrew Eikum
winecfg: Rep
l
ace
D
i
r
e
ctSound sett
i
n
g
s with Dri
v
er Diagnostics
.
commit
|
commitdiff
|
tree
2011-09-26
A
n
drew Eikum
dsound: Valid
a
t
e buffer pointers in U
n
lock
methods
.
commit
|
commitdiff
|
tree
2011-09-26
An
d
rew
Eikum
ds
o
und: Remove har
d
ware acceleration
support
.
commit
|
commitdiff
|
tree
2011-09-26
Andrew Eikum
winecoreaudio
.
d
r
v: R
e
move
w
a
v
e, mixer, and
d
s
ound
driver
.
.
.
commit
|
commitdiff
|
tree
2011-09-26
Andrew E
i
kum
win
e
oss
.
drv
:
Remove w
a
ve, mixer, and dsound driver
.
.
.
commit
|
commitdiff
|
tree
2011-09-26
Andrew Eikum
wine
a
lsa
.
drv: Remove wave, mi
x
er
,
and dsoun
d
driver
.
.
.
commit
|
commitdiff
|
tree
2011-09-21
A
ndrew E
i
kum
dsound:
Don't derefere
n
ce a freed object
.
commit
|
commitdiff
|
tree
2011-09-15
And
r
ew Eikum
win
e
alsa
.
drv: Allow creation of t
h
e
d
e
f
au
l
t device
.
.
.
commit
|
commitdiff
|
tree
2011-09-01
Andrew Eiku
m
wi
n
ecfg: Remove
d
r
iver
s
elect
i
on from Audio tab
.
commit
|
commitdiff
|
tree
2011-09-01
Andre
w
Eikum
mmdevap
i
: A
u
tomatically select
t
he correct dri
v
er
.
commit
|
commitdiff
|
tree
2011-09-01
Andrew Eikum
winmm:
Determ
i
ne the
d
river from MMD
e
vAPI
.
commit
|
commitdiff
|
tree
2011-08-23
A
ndr
e
w Eikum
mmdevapi: Dis
a
ble sound if the user explicitly select
s
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
An
d
rew E
i
kum
winealsa
.
drv: I
n
ject han
d
le_u
n
derrun=1 se
t
ting fo
r
.
.
.
commit
|
commitdiff
|
tree
2011-08-05
A
n
drew Eikum
wineal
s
a
.
dr
v
: T
e
ll ALSA to play silence dur
i
ng u
n
derruns
.
commit
|
commitdiff
|
tree
2011-08-02
A
ndrew
E
ikum
win
m
m: Fix looping handling
.
commit
|
commitdiff
|
tree
2011-07-27
Andrew Eikum
wineoss
.
drv: Choose
default devic
e
using a bett
e
r method
.
commit
|
commitdiff
|
tree
2011-07-27
Andrew Eikum
winealsa
.
drv: Fix AudioRende
r
Client w
r
ite
p
ointer c
a
lculatio
n
.
commit
|
commitdiff
|
tree
2011-07-26
Andr
e
w Eikum
mmdev
a
pi: T
r
y l
o
a
ding multip
l
e audio drivers from the
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
A
ndrew
Eikum
winmm: Fi
x
ch
e
ck f
o
r
DCB_NULL callback
t
ype
.
commit
|
commitdiff
|
tree
2011-07-18
Andrew Eikum
w
i
nm
m
: Perfo
r
m Open an
d
Close callbacks fro
m
client
.
.
.
commit
|
commitdiff
|
tree
2011-07-18
A
ndrew Eikum
winmm: Close AC
M
s
t
ream when cl
o
sing wav
e
device
.
commit
|
commitdiff
|
tree
2011-07-18
Andrew Eikum
mmdevapi: Use a sane
d
efau
l
t if n
o
buffer size is requested
.
commit
|
commitdiff
|
tree
2011-07-15
Andrew
E
ikum
winejack
.
drv:
R
emove
unus
e
d WinMM d
r
iver
.
commit
|
commitdiff
|
tree
2011-07-15
Andrew Eikum
winee
s
d
.
drv: Remove unused Win
M
M driver
.
commit
|
commitdiff
|
tree
2011-07-15
Andrew E
i
k
u
m
w
i
nena
s
.
drv: Remo
v
e unused
W
inMM
d
rive
r
.
commit
|
commitdiff
|
tree
2011-07-15
Andrew Ei
k
um
winmm:
Implement
m
ixer*
o
n top of MM
D
evAPI
.
commit
|
commitdiff
|
tree
2011-07-15
An
d
rew Eikum
wi
n
mm: Rem
o
ve
driver implementati
o
n of mixer
*
.
commit
|
commitdiff
|
tree
2011-07-14
Andrew Eikum
winm
m
: Implement waveIn
*
on top of MMDevAP
I
.
commit
|
commitdiff
|
tree
2011-07-14
Andrew
Eik
u
m
winmm: Re
m
ov
e
drive
r
implementat
i
o
n of waveIn*
.
commit
|
commitdiff
|
tree
2011-07-14
An
d
re
w
Eik
u
m
w
inmm:
Suppo
r
t WAVE_MAPPED flag
i
n waveOut*
.
commit
|
commitdiff
|
tree
2011-07-14
Andrew
E
i
ku
m
dsound: Request
t
hat WinMM perform audio
c
onversio
n
.
.
.
commit
|
commitdiff
|
tree
2011-07-14
Andrew E
i
kum
mmdevapi: Only en
u
merate devices t
h
at can
b
e o
p
e
ned
.
.
.
commit
|
commitdiff
|
tree
2011-07-12
And
r
ew Eikum
winmm: Implement
waveOut* on t
o
p of
M
M
D
evAPI
.
commit
|
commitdiff
|
tree
2011-07-12
Andrew Eikum
w
i
nmm: Remov
e
driver impl
e
m
ent
a
tion of waveOut*
.
commit
|
commitdiff
|
tree
2011-07-11
Andrew
Ei
k
um
wine
c
or
e
a
u
dio
.
d
r
v
:
Make AudioSessionManager method
s
.
.
.
commit
|
commitdiff
|
tree
2011-07-05
Andrew Eikum
winm
m
/
t
ests:
D
on't test MCI
o
utput if
n
o output devices
.
.
.
commit
|
commitdiff
|
tree
2011-06-29
Andrew E
i
k
u
m
w
i
n
m
m: Pull wave and mixer functions int
o
their own
.
.
.
commit
|
commitdiff
|
tree
next